SYSTEM AND METHOD FOR DYNAMIC CONTROL OF SHARED MEMORY MANAGEMENT RESOURCES

A method and system for dynamic control of shared memory resources within a portable computing device ("PCD") are disclosed. A limit request of an unacceptable deadline miss ("UDM") engine of the portable computing device may be determined with a limit request sensor within the U...

Full description

Saved in:
Bibliographic Details
Main Authors VARIA, Meghal, PODAIMA, Jason Edward, GADELRAB, Serag, ERNEWEIN, Kyle
Format Patent
LanguageEnglish
French
Published 07.09.2018
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:A method and system for dynamic control of shared memory resources within a portable computing device ("PCD") are disclosed. A limit request of an unacceptable deadline miss ("UDM") engine of the portable computing device may be determined with a limit request sensor within the UDM element. Next, a memory management unit modifies a shared memory resource arbitration policy in view of the limit request. By modifying the shared memory resource arbitration policy, the memory management unit may smartly allocate resources to service translation requests separately queued based on having emanated from either a flooding engine or a non-flooding engine. L'invention concerne un procédé et un système de commande dynamique de ressources de mémoire partagées dans un dispositif informatique portable (« PCD »). Une demande de limite d'un moteur de manquement de date limite inacceptable (« UDM ») du dispositif informatique portable peut être déterminée à l'aide d'un capteur de demande de limite dans l'élément UDM. Ensuite, une unité de gestion de mémoire modifie une politique d'arbitrage de ressources de mémoire partagée en considération de la demande de limite. En modifiant la politique d'arbitrage de ressources de mémoire partagée, l'unité de gestion de mémoire peut affecter de manière intelligente des ressources à des demandes de traduction de service mises en file d'attente séparément selon qu'elles proviennent d'un moteur d'inondation ou d'un moteur de non-inondation.
Bibliography:Application Number: WO2018US18423